Project Summary
Migration and asylum seekers are a major challenge for Europe today. The integration of migrants and refugee flows have become the subject of lively debate throughout Europe. The project “MIGRANTECH : the digital incubator as a springboard for learning and employment of migrants and refugees” contributes to combating discrimination against migrants and/or refugees; promoting coexistence between society and migrant and/or refugee communities; and undertaking education and training as a key element in promoting social cohesion and integration processes; providing tailor-made e-learning tools and methods for professionals working with migrants and refugees, in order to facilitate their socio-professional inclusion; understanding and identifying the needs for the most relevant knowledge, attitudes and skills sought by enterprises and employers/companies. In addition, MIGRANTECH will enable educators and professionals to broaden and adapt their knowledge and develop skills such as collaboration, digital literacy in job search, information management, evaluation of these skills, experimentation and innovation, problem solving and decision making, all of which are stepping stones towards bringing their audiences closer to the labour market.
The 4 EU entities from France, Belgium, Portugal and Turkey, will achieve the project objectives by carrying out a study on policies and good practices in the field of social and professional integration of migrants and refugees, in order to analyse what has already been implemented and how to learn from past experiences; development of methodological and intervention tools and didactic material to promote the social and professional situation of migrants and refugees ; undertaking in each partner country itineraries with a total of 160 migrants and/or refugees to test intervention tools, a seminar for the exchange of good practices and the training of e-tutors to develop the skills of professionals working with migrants/refugees and to improve best practices in migrant entrepreneurship and professional integration processes. In this context, the project proposes the design and development of an inclusive, interactive and user-friendly platform (digital toolbox, e-learning, etc.) for professionals involved in adult education that will include online training modules for the socio-cultural, political and economic integration of migrants/refugees. More specifically, the training programme will help professionals to receive education about the EU (rights, obligations, values, opportunities, skills, digital…) in a way that will facilitate the smooth integration of the migrants and refugees with whom they work into European societies.
The partnership will produce the following 5 intellectual outputs:
o O1 Elaboration of the study on the most relevant transversal, key and digital competences required for access to employment and sought by enterprises
o O2 Identification of good educational and integration practices for adult migrants and refugees, both online and offline, based on NICTs and cross-cutting skills sought by companies and employers. and a tool for certifying acquired skills.
o O3 Kit in the form of a training path (40 e-modules) developed according to the skills identified or sought by companies, employers and orientation of the seminar for the exchange of good practices during A4
o O4 Design of the e-platform and putting the 40 e-modules online in an interactive approach (objectives, content, evaluation questionnaire.)
o O5 Creation of an e-learning guide capitalising on the e-learning path and how to use the platform and 2 relevant computer graphics (transversal and digital skills) for people involved in adult education.
MIGRANTECH meets the objectives of Erasmus+ :
–Providing innovative educational practice based on NICTs that will motivate adults to engage in active learning and education accessible to all.
-Designing and developing inclusive training initiatives and new practices in line with the Paris Declaration, to meet the needs of disadvantaged groups, addressing diversity in training, developing key competences and digital skills promoting the inclusion of refugees and migrants.
